Hi All,
I've just moved to France and had a quote for over 500 - yes 500! euros to install my satellite dish (which I already have!) and setup my Sky (which I also already have as I brought it to France with me). Unbelievable. I really want to align the sky satellite dish myself as I have a pretty good idea (at least I think so) of how to wire it up. I've got cable and f-connectors sorted, just need to align the right satellite. Does anyone know which satellite to point at (which direction)? I have just bought a satellite finder tool too but not sure where to aim the dish. Thanks ![]() Stan |

28.2 east is the direction, use dishpointer.com to help you.
